开源游戏存档工具:重新定义你的游戏体验
你是否曾遇到过这样的困境:花费数十小时精心培养的游戏角色因存档损坏而化为乌有?或者在尝试不同游戏路线时,因存档数量限制而束手束脚?开源游戏存档工具正是为解决这些痛点而生,它不仅是一款功能强大的编辑器,更是游戏玩家的数字时光机,让你在虚拟世界中拥有更多自主权。
问题探索:游戏存档的隐形枷锁
在《塞尔达传说:旷野之息》中,一位玩家在击败最终Boss前意外丢失了包含数百小时进度的存档,其中包括所有稀有装备和已探索的地图区域。这并非个例,传统游戏存档系统存在三大核心痛点:存档文件易损坏、多平台兼容性差、编辑功能受限。这些问题不仅影响游戏体验,更可能导致玩家数月的心血付诸东流。
开源游戏存档工具通过HTML5技术栈,将复杂的二进制存档文件转换为可视化的编辑界面。想象一下,当你在《任天猫狗》中想要为宠物更换稀有饰品时,不再需要完成特定任务,而是直接在编辑器中选择所需物品。这种自由度的提升,正是该工具的核心价值所在。
技术解析:HTML5带来的存档革命
本地化数据处理的隐私保护机制
该工具最引人注目的技术亮点在于其本地化数据处理架构。与传统客户端软件不同,所有存档解析和编辑操作都在浏览器本地完成,不会将任何个人游戏数据上传至服务器。这一设计不仅确保了隐私安全,还避免了网络延迟问题。技术实现上,工具使用IndexedDB(一种浏览器内置的本地数据库)存储临时编辑数据,结合Web Workers实现多线程处理,确保即使处理大型存档文件也不会导致界面卡顿。
多平台存档格式转换原理
面对不同游戏平台(如Switch、PS4、PC)的存档格式差异,工具采用了模块化的解析器设计。每个游戏对应一个独立的解析模块,包含特定的文件格式定义和数据结构映射。例如,在处理《塞尔达传说:旷野之息》的存档时,工具会先解析SAV文件的二进制结构,将其转换为JSON格式(一种轻量级数据交换格式),编辑完成后再反向转换为原始格式。这种设计使得添加新游戏支持变得异常简单,只需编写新的解析模块即可。
社区贡献者生态建设
项目的可持续发展离不开活跃的社区支持。工具采用插件化架构,允许社区开发者为新游戏编写解析模块和编辑界面。贡献者只需遵循简单的API规范,即可将自己开发的模块提交至官方仓库。这种开源协作模式不仅加速了新游戏支持的速度,还形成了一个知识共享的社区生态。目前,社区已为超过20款热门游戏开发了完整的编辑支持,其中包括《超级马里奥》系列和《宝可梦》系列等大作。
场景实践:跨平台存档编辑的真实案例
游戏进度修复方案
一位《乐高大电影:游戏版》玩家在遭遇存档损坏后,通过该工具成功恢复了90%的游戏进度。工具的损坏检测算法能够识别并修复常见的存档错误,如校验和不匹配、数据块损坏等。更令人印象深刻的是,它还能智能恢复部分丢失的游戏数据,如已收集的道具和完成的任务。
存档数据可视化
在《塞尔达传说:旷野之息》中,玩家可以通过工具直观地查看和编辑角色的装备、物品和状态。工具将抽象的二进制数据转换为生动的视觉元素,如盔甲的3D预览、物品的图标展示等。这种可视化编辑极大降低了操作门槛,即使是没有技术背景的玩家也能轻松上手。
资源工具箱
- 官方文档:docs/advanced-editing.md
- 常见问题解决:troubleshooting/archive-errors.md
- 社区贡献指南:CONTRIBUTING.md
读者挑战
- 如果你是一名独立游戏开发者,你会如何设计存档系统以更好地支持第三方编辑工具?
- 在多人在线游戏中,存档编辑可能会破坏游戏平衡,你认为应该如何在开放与公平之间找到平衡点?
欢迎在项目讨论区分享你的想法和解决方案。无论你是游戏玩家、开发者还是开源爱好者,开源游戏存档工具都为你提供了一个重新定义游戏体验的机会。通过Git获取项目:
git clone https://gitcode.com/gh_mirrors/sa/savegame-editors
开始探索这个强大工具的无限可能,释放你的游戏创造力吧!开源游戏存档工具不仅是一款软件,更是游戏玩家社区共同智慧的结晶,它正在悄然改变我们与虚拟世界的互动方式。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ust099-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iMo-V2.5-ProMiMo-V2.5-Pro作为旗舰模型,擅⻓处理复杂Agent任务,单次任务可完成近千次⼯具调⽤与⼗余轮上 下⽂压缩。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00



